Winter: December to February

Winter turns Liechtenstein into a snowy wonderland, perfect for those who love the cold and winter sports. With temperatures often dipping below freezing, it's the ideal season for skiing and snowboarding. The Malbun area becomes a hotspot for winter activities. Don't miss the Magic of Advent, a charming Christmas market in Vaduz, that lights up the city with festive cheer.

Spring: March to May

As the snow melts, Liechtenstein bursts into vibrant colors. Spring is when to visit if you enjoy nature's rebirth. Temperatures range from mild to warm, making it pleasant for exploring the outdoors. This is a great time for hiking and witnessing the blossoming landscapes. The Easter Market in Vaduz is a highlight, showcasing local crafts and foods.

Summer: June to August

Summer is the best time to visit for those who love warm weather and outdoor adventures. With temperatures comfortably sitting in the 20s (Celsius), you can indulge in hiking, cycling, and enjoying the lush greenery. Don't miss the Liechtenstein Festival in August, where you can enjoy local music, food, and culture under the sun.

Fall: September to November

Fall in Liechtenstein is all about the stunning foliage. The landscape turns into shades of orange and red, offering breathtaking views. It's a cooler time of year, perfect for long walks and enjoying the cozy atmosphere. Wine enthusiasts will appreciate the Wine Tasting Festival in Vaduz, where you can sample local vintages.

Winter in Liechtenstein

When pondering the best time to visit Liechtenstein, winter stands out for its unique charm and array of activities, especially if you're fond of the colder climate or eager to experience winter sports. From December through February, Liechtenstein transforms into a winter wonderland, offering a picturesque setting that could easily be the background of a festive holiday card.

Temperature-wise, expect the mercury to drop, with averages hovering around 0°C (32°F) - perfect for those who enjoy the crisp, winter air. Despite the chill, the beauty of the snow-covered landscape is truly a sight to behold, making it worth bundling up for.

Winter in Liechtenstein is a haven for sports enthusiasts. With its pristine, snow-covered mountains, it's an ideal time for skiing, snowboarding, and sledging. The country boasts well-maintained ski resorts that cater to all levels, from beginners to advanced skiers. Malbun is a popular destination, known for its family-friendly slopes and breathtaking views. If you're someone who prefers the thrill of off-piste skiing, you'll find plenty of opportunities to explore the unmarked trails safely.

For those who lean more towards cultural experiences, winter does not disappoint. Liechtenstein's festive season is palpable in the air, with Christmas markets popping up in town squares, exuding warmth, light, and the scent of mulled wine. In February, don't miss the opportunity to witness or even participate in the Carnival (Fasnacht), a vibrant celebration filled with parades, music, and traditional costumes that breathe life into the cold months.

Imagine walking through serene trails, the snow crunching underfoot, amidst the quiet of winter – Liechtenstein offers ample hiking opportunities tailored for the colder months. Guided winter hikes can introduce you to the magic of the season, from frosted forests to icy waterfalls, all while keeping you safely on the path.
